>>> I recently upgraded from Kubuntu 14.04 to 14.10. With the current 
>>> master I
>>> get a core dump when starting QGIS. I removed the build directory and
>>> recreated the settings with ccmake. The compile works fine but when 
>>> I start
>>> QGIS I get a core dump. Here are the startup messages:
>>>
>>> -------------------------------------
>>>
>>> Warning: loading of qt translation failed
>>> [/usr/share/qt4/translations/qt_en_US]
>>> Warning: Bus::open: Can not get ibus-daemon's address.
>>> IBusInputContext::createInputContext: no connection to ibus-daemon
>>> Warning: QGraphicsScene::addItem: item has already been added to 
>>> this scene
>>> QGIS died on signal 11Could not attach to process.  If your uid 
>>> matches the
>>> uid of the target
>>> process, check the setting of /proc/sys/kernel/yama/ptrace_scope, or 
>>> try
>>> again as the root user.  For more details, see 
>>> /etc/sysctl.d/10-ptrace.conf
>>> ptrace: Operation not permitted.
>>> No thread selected
>>> No stack.
>>> gdb returned 0
>>> Aborted (core dumped)
>>>
>>> ---------------------------
>>>
>>> I see the splash screen and immediately get a core dump. I don't 
>>> even see
>>> the main application window.
>>>
>>> I wonder if there is a library problem after my Ubuntu update?
